NCT ID: NCT04483518 Completed - Clinical trials for Observe and Describe the Prevalence of Hepatitis D Infection Among HBsAg Positive People

Epidemiological Survey of Hepatitis D Virus Infection in China

Start date: June 3, 2019
Phase:
Study type: Observational

This cross-sectional study will screen out hepatitis D virus-infected patients in HBsAg-positive people. Observe and describe the prevalence of hepatitis D infection among HBsAg positive people. The provinces of China are divided into 5 geographical areas (North, South, East, West and Central) to recruit patients according to the population density of each area. After statistical calculation, the total number of population needed is 3808.

NCT ID: NCT04480294 Active, not recruiting - Chronic Hepatitis B Clinical Trials

A Phase I Study to Evaluate the Safety, Tolerability, Pharmacokinetics, Pharmacodynamics and Food Effect of Oral HRS5091 in Healthy Subjects and Chronic Hepatitis B Patients

Start date: July 28, 2020
Phase: Phase 1
Study type: Interventional

The study is a randomized, Double-Blind, Placebo-Controlled study to evaluate the safety, tolerability and pharmacokinetics, pharmacodynamics and food effect of HRS5091. The study will be conducted in three parts sequentially: Part 1a will consist of 58 healthy subjects, 5 groups. The purpose of this part is to explore the safety, tolerability and pharmacokinetics of single doses of HRS5091 tablet in healthy subjects. Part 1b will consist of 18 healthy subjects and it is one of groups in Part 1a.The purpose of this part is to explore food effect of HRS5091 in healthy subjects. Part 1c will consist of 10 healthy subjects, 1 groups. The purpose of this part is to explore the safety, tolerability and pharmacokinetics of multiple doses of HRS5091 tablet in healthy subjects. Part 2 will consist of 30 CHB patients.The purpose of this part is to explore the safety, tolerability and pharmacokinetics, pharmacodynamics of multiple doses of HRS5091 tablet in naïve and treatment-discontinued chronic hepatitis B (CHB) patients.

NCT ID: NCT04459897 Recruiting - Clinical trials for Patient Diagnosed or Treated for Granulomatous Hepatitis Followed in the Internal Medicine (and or) Hepato-gastroenterology Departments

Lyon Granulomatous Hepatitis Study

LGH
Start date: January 1, 2019
Phase:
Study type: Observational

Granulomatous hepatitis are histopathologically defined by the presence of epithelioid and gigantocellular granulomas within the hepatic parenchyma. Hepatic granulomas are observed in 2 to 15% of liver biopsies. Causes of granulomatous hepatitis can be related to ethnic and environmental factors and in western countries granulomatous hepatitis are mostly related to sarcoidosis and autoimmune cholangitis. Infections (mycobacteria, coxiella burnetii, hepatitis C) and medications also provide granulomatous hepatitis. Sarcoidosis is a systemic disease of unknown etiology, which in third of cases has a chronic course. Five percent of patients die of their disease, mainly because of respiratory distress. Hepatic involvement is most often asymptomatic or pauci-symptomatic (moderate cholestasis and conglomerates of granulomas visible on imaging). More rarely, it can cause portal hypertension and its complications and be life-threatening. The aim of the Lyon Hepatitis Granulomatous (LHG) study is to better characterize granulomatous hepatitis and within these, severe hepatic sarcoidosis. This is a retrospective study conducted from January 2008 to December 2016 proposed to all patients with granulomatous hepatitis followed in the internal medicine and / or Hepato-gastroenterology departments (Croix-Rousse Hospital, Edouard-Herriot Hospital, Lyon Sud Hospital Center). This study will cover 596 patients who had a liver biopsy showing granulomas. The main objectives of the Lyon Hepatitis Granulomatous (LHG) study are to analyze i) the etiology of the disease and the contribution of molecular biology for infectious etiologies, ii) the contribution of nuclear imaging for sarcoidosis diagnosis versus conventional imaging, iii) treatment used and prognosis. This study will permit a better characterization of granulomatous hepatitis, and liver sarcoidosis in terms of prognosis as well as therapeutic management.
